US Economic Optimism Inches Upward in February amid Encouraging Outlook

The latest data from the IBD/TIPP Economic Optimism Index shows a minor yet noticeable upward movement in the United States' economic sentiment. As of February 2025, the index has increased slightly from 51.9 to 52.0. Released on February 4, 2025, this data suggests a marginal yet positive shift in public confidence regarding economic conditions.

This current standing at 52.0, emerging from January's figure of 51.9, represents a continuing trend above the neutral mark of 50—a benchmark indicative of positive economic prospects among consumers. For the first month of 2025, this change might not seem drastic but hints at a steadying faith in economic recovery and growth, with citizens expressing cautious optimism about future economic stability.

As the economic landscape remains dynamic, stakeholders are eager to see whether this optimistic trend will solidify further, reflecting potentially more robust economic health. Economic analysts hence remain vigilant, assessing other indices and financial indicators to obtain a fuller picture of the USA's economic trajectory going forward into the year.
